Product Parameters

ETHYL 2-(METHYLSULFONYL)PYRIMIDINE-5-CARBOXYLATE CAS:148550-51-0 is a white to off-white crystalline solid with a melting point of 130-135°C. It is soluble in organic solvents such as methanol, ethanol, and acetone, but sparingly soluble in water. The molecular formula of this compound is C8H7N3O4S, and its molecular weight is 243.27 g/mol.
